Friday, 15 January, 2016 0330h Stratford

It was a dark and cold (-12C/-21WC) morning as we stumbled around getting a quick breakfast before our taxi came. Our taxi came and the flight from Charlottetown took off with no problem. There was no time in Toronto to really look around because of the time needed to clear US Customs. Two security checks and six different lines to scan our boarding passes, going to a machine to take your picture for Homeland Security. I mean why else would you need another photo when you have your passport. Once on the plane with no time to spare, we were off to Tampa.

Once in Tampa, we called our hotel and the shuttle picked us up. What a transformation in temperature! Even though the locals were freezing, we thought that 20C was quite pleasant. For lunch, we went around the corner to the Brick House Pub – see the picture on Gail's facebook page. It is a huge pub with great service, which is something the Americans do well and good food and cold beer. If our dollar had been worth a dollar, it would also have been a bargain! As a matter of fact, we ended up going back for dinner as it was so close.


Travel Note: I paid $1.4975 for US$ at the bank.
